Time Out says

Assembling more than 250 cloak clasps, hair ornaments, pins, brooches, rings, bracelets, pendants and necklaces, "Maker & Muse: Women and Early Twentieth Century Art Jewelry" explores jewelry created between the Victorian Era and World War I. The exhibition highlights the influential women who wore these pieces as well as the female jewelry makers who rose to prominence during the period.
